Output bf8efb559faa53606bf441a79094eaaa23dea052fc7cc01d72a434e1a9129304:90

value
13893
script pubkey
OP_0 OP_PUSHBYTES_20 fc7064c1c994b6da694b940a907a73f022aa951a
address
bc1ql3cxfswfjjmd562tjs9fq7nn7q3249g67nely0
transaction
bf8efb559faa53606bf441a79094eaaa23dea052fc7cc01d72a434e1a9129304
confirmations
32335
spent
true